Definitions:

Experimenter Bias

Experimenter bias is a form of bias that occurs when a researcher's expectations or preferences about the outcome of a study influence the results.

Placebo Control Group

A group of participants in a study who receive a sham treatment, allowing for the comparison of the actual intervention’s effectiveness.

Socially Desirable

Pertains to behaviors or responses that are seen as favorable by society and are thus more likely to be expressed by individuals.

Social Desirability Bias

The tendency of survey respondents to answer questions in a manner that will be viewed favorably by others.
